Council rejects rezoning request to legalize carport at 552 Arborbrook Lane

After a public hearing with neighborhood support, the council voted down a planned-development request to allow a carport that encroaches on the side-yard setback; applicant said contractor built without permit and neighborhood petition backed the request.

The Coppell City Council denied a rezoning request Jan. 14 that would have allowed a carport constructed at 552 Arborbrook Lane to remain in its current location despite encroaching into the required side-yard setback.

Planning staff told council the carport and other improvements were constructed in 2022 without permits, and a building permit applied for after construction was denied because the carport did not meet the zoning ordinance's setback requirements.
